On July 30, 2026, an investor in NASDAQ: CAPR shares filed lawsuit over alleged securities laws violations by Capricor Therapeutics, Inc. The plaintiff alleges that the defendants made false and/or misleading statements and/or failed to disclose that Capricor Therapeutics, Inc. adopted changes to the pre-specified statistical analysis plan used to analyze clinical data for Deramiocel, that the FDA had not agreed to those changes before Capricor Therapeutics, Inc. resubmitted the Deramiocel Biologics License Application (“BLA”), that as a result, there was a significant risk that the FDA could conclude the clinical results did not provide substantial evidence of effectiveness of Deramiocel, and that as a result of the foregoing, there was a substantial risk to regulatory approval of Deramiocel for the treatment of Duchenne muscular dystrophy.
